Bootstrap 是一个流行的前端框架,它可以帮助开发者快速搭建响应式、移动优先的网站。通过合理搭配 Bootstrap 的组件和工具,可以轻松打造出具有个性化和视觉冲击力的网站。本文将详细介绍 Bootstrap 的搭配技巧,帮助您解锁视觉盛宴。

一、了解Bootstrap

Bootstrap 是一个基于 HTML、CSS 和 JavaScript 的前端框架,它提供了一套响应式、移动优先的样式和组件。Bootstrap 的设计理念是简洁、高效,它可以帮助开发者节省时间,提高工作效率。

二、Bootstrap搭配技巧

1. 选择合适的Bootstrap版本

Bootstrap 提供了多个版本,包括 Bootstrap 3 和 Bootstrap 4。在选择版本时,需要考虑以下因素:

  • 兼容性:Bootstrap 4 相比 Bootstrap 3,在移动端的支持更好,但同时也存在一些兼容性问题。
  • 组件和工具:Bootstrap 4 中的组件和工具比 Bootstrap 3 更丰富,但 Bootstrap 3 中的某些组件在 Bootstrap 4 中可能已经不再存在。

2. 利用Bootstrap网格系统

Bootstrap 的网格系统是构建响应式布局的基础。通过合理使用网格系统,可以确保网站在不同设备上具有良好的显示效果。

<div class="container">
  <div class="row">
    <div class="col-md-4">Column 1</div>
    <div class="col-md-4">Column 2</div>
    <div class="col-md-4">Column 3</div>
  </div>
</div>

3. 选择合适的主题

Bootstrap 提供了多种主题,您可以根据自己的需求选择合适的主题。主题可以改变网站的整体风格,包括颜色、字体等。

4. 使用Bootstrap组件

Bootstrap 提供了丰富的组件,如按钮、表单、导航栏、模态框等。通过合理使用这些组件,可以提升网站的交互性和用户体验。

<button type="button" class="btn btn-primary">Primary</button>
<button type="button" class="btn btn-secondary">Secondary</button>
<button type="button" class="btn btn-success">Success</button>

5. 定制Bootstrap

如果您对 Bootstrap 的默认样式不满意,可以通过定制来满足自己的需求。定制可以通过修改 Bootstrap 的 Less 文件或引入自定义的 CSS 文件来实现。

// 自定义按钮样式
.btn-custom {
  background-color: #3498db;
  border-color: #2980b9;
  color: #fff;
}

三、案例分析

以下是一个使用 Bootstrap 搭建的简单个人博客网站案例:

<!DOCTYPE html>
<html lang="zh-CN">
<head>
  <meta charset="UTF-8">
  <meta name="viewport" content="width=device-width, initial-scale=1.0">
  <link rel="stylesheet" href="https://cdn.staticfile.org/twitter-bootstrap/4.3.1/css/bootstrap.min.css">
  <title>个人博客</title>
</head>
<body>
  <div class="container">
    <header>
      <h1>个人博客</h1>
    </header>
    <main>
      <article>
        <h2>文章标题</h2>
        <p>文章内容...</p>
      </article>
    </main>
    <footer>
      <p>版权所有 &copy; 2023</p>
    </footer>
  </div>
  <script src="https://cdn.staticfile.org/jquery/3.2.1/jquery.min.js"></script>
  <script src="https://cdn.staticfile.org/popper.js/1.15.0/umd/popper.min.js"></script>
  <script src="https://cdn.staticfile.org/twitter-bootstrap/4.3.1/js/bootstrap.min.js"></script>
</body>
</html>

通过以上案例,我们可以看到 Bootstrap 的简单易用性,以及它如何帮助开发者快速搭建具有个性化和视觉冲击力的网站。

四、总结

Bootstrap 是一个功能强大的前端框架,通过掌握其搭配技巧,可以轻松打造出个性化和视觉盛宴的网站。希望本文能帮助您更好地利用 Bootstrap,提升您的网站开发能力。